F&M Bank quarterly financials

As reported to the FDIC. Dollar values are period-end balances. Net income is for the single quarter, derived from the FDIC's year-to-date figures by subtracting the prior quarter's report. Ratios (ROA, ROE, NIM) are FDIC-computed annualized year-to-date values.

QuarterAssetsDepositsNet loansEquityNet incomeROAROENIMNoncurrent
Q1 2026$925M$789M$658M$95M$3M1.19%10.98%4.47%1.64%
Q4 2025$810M$668M$595M$93M$2M1.45%12.63%4.28%1.84%
Q3 2025$758M$623M$570M$92M$3M1.67%14.51%4.26%2.01%
Q2 2025$759M$653M$557M$89M$4M1.84%16.26%4.23%0.45%
Q1 2025$753M$655M$535M$87M$3M1.76%15.92%4.09%0.57%
Q4 2024$772M$642M$556M$82M$3M1.56%15.11%3.85%0.62%
Q3 2024$771M$644M$544M$81M$3M1.54%15.12%3.83%0.49%
Q2 2024$747M$646M$500M$77M$3M1.58%15.72%3.84%0.73%
Q1 2024$753M$654M$506M$76M$3M1.62%16.28%3.87%0.88%
Q4 2023$738M$639M$498M$73M$2M1.65%16.98%3.94%1.10%
Q3 2023$670M$582M$437M$68M$3M1.77%18.23%4.03%0.44%
Q2 2023$685M$592M$448M$66M$3M1.78%18.70%3.99%0.15%

Transcribed from FDIC BankFind Suite quarterly financial data (Call Report-derived). Income in Call Reports is filed year-to-date; per-quarter net income shown here is the difference between consecutive reports within the same year. NIM = net interest margin; “Noncurrent” = noncurrent loans as a share of total loans. These figures describe reported financials only and are not a safety rating or a prediction about the institution.
